The stars of Liverpool and Man City are the big favorites to win the award for best player of the season in the Premier League

Mohamed Salah & Kevin de Bruyne

As the football season in the Premier League comes to an end, we will again have the top footballer of the season. Last year was the Portuguese central defender of Manchester City, Ruben Dias.


This year, the candidates are the Liverpool winger, Mohamed Salah, who has made and continues to make amazing appearances, and the Manchester City playmaker, Kevin De Bruyne. These two footballers are presented as the big favorites, among the eight nominees for the "Footballer of the Season" award in the Premier League.


Salah is the top scorer in the league with 22 goals, while he also has 13 assists, and De Bruyne is fourth in the scorers' table with 15 goals and seven assists.


Both Salah and De Bruyne have won the award in the past, the 2017-18 and 2019-20 seasons respectively.


The other candidates are: Trent Alexander-Arnold (Liverpool), Joao Cancello (City), Jarrod Bowen (West Ham), Bukayo Saka (Arsenal), Sean Heung-Min (Tottenham) and  James  Ward-Prowse ( Southampton).

8 Nominees for the Young


In the end we have and  the 8  nominees for the Young Player of the 2021/22 Season.

The eight players are Trent Alexander-Arnold (Liverpool), Bukayo Saka (Arsenal) , Phil Foden (Man. City), Conor Gallagher (Crystal Palace) , Tyrick Mitchell (Crystal Palace) , Mason Mount (Chelsea), Aaron Ramsdale (Arsenal)  and Declan Rice (Wedt Ham).
